The Unseen Connection: Love is Blind

“Love is Blind” revolutionizes the pursuit of romance by challenging the conventional emphasis on physical attraction. Within the unique setup of isolated pods, participants engage in heartfelt conversations, their voices bridging the gap between them. This barrier to the physical world encourages a dive into the depths of personal stories, beliefs, and dreams, fostering connections that are purely emotional and intellectually aligned.

The beauty of this approach unfolds as these bonds, formed without the bias of physical appearance, transition into the real world. Remarkably, several couples have navigated the journey from pod conversations to the altar, their relationships culminating in marriage and the joy of starting families. These success stories serve as compelling evidence that when connections are rooted in mutual understanding and emotional resonance, they have the potential to flourish beyond the confines of the show.

Through its innovative format, “Love is Blind” illuminates the essence of human connection, suggesting that the strongest relationships are built on the foundations of emotional intimacy and shared values. It offers viewers a glimpse into the transformative power of communication and vulnerability, highlighting how love, in its purest form, transcends physical boundaries.

Family Affairs: My Mom Your Dad

“My Mom Your Dad” innovatively blends the quest for love with family dynamics, inviting single parents into a dating scenario orchestrated by their own children. This unique premise adds a layer of warmth and sincerity to the reality dating scene, as offspring play cupid in the hopes of finding new love for their parents. By doing so, the show not only focuses on romance but also on strengthening family bonds.

The intrigue begins as these parents, guided by the unseen hands of their children, embark on a journey filled with potential love interests, all while remaining oblivious to the familial puppeteers behind the scenes. This element of surprise and the children’s involvement add an emotional depth to the show, creating a narrative that resonates with viewers who value family as much as romance.
